The Lady Kings escaped with a 28-27 win against the Quilcene Rangers in girls varsity basketball last week in Auburn.
Quilcene ended the week with a loss to the Lions, 44-23, against Sound Christian Academy in Tacoma.
The pair of losses left Quilcene with an overall record of 2-8 (1-3 conference).
The Rangers were scheduled to return to action Tuesday on the road against Puget Sound Adventist Academy.
Quilcene will come home to play Thursday for the first time in two weeks with a matchup against the Northwest Yeshiva Lions.
